Information security is based on cryptography, steganography or combination of both. Cryptography is used to collapse and lock the meaning conveyed by the secret message by making it understandable only to the users with a specific key to unlock the secret. The steganography and watermarking intentionally make an unintended message visible to all that serves as cover to suppress the guess on the presence of secret behind the medium.
Lightweight encryption schemes designed for crypto applications on resource-constrained embedded devices are known as Light Weight Cryptography (LWC). They are often used for data security in IoT devices.
